Restaurant Overview
Features and Specialities
- A Rare “Non-Tonkotsu” Gem in Kumamoto : In Kumamoto, where rich pork-bone broth reigns supreme, “Ramenya Taketonbo” stands out as a beloved shop specializing in high-quality soy sauce (Shoyu) and miso ramen.
- The Perfect Balance of Miso : Their most popular dish, the Miso Ramen, features a smooth, rich miso flavor with a crisp, savory finish. Toppings like sweet corn and aromatic charred green onions add excellent textural and flavor accents.
- Exceptional Side Dishes from a Former Chef : The owner, who has a background as a professional chef, creates outstanding side dishes and daily specials (such as tender pigs trotters, sashimi, and skewers). Many regular customers visit specifically to enjoy these dishes with a drink before finishing up with ramen.

Google Reviews Analysis
| Item | Details |
|---|---|
| Overall Rating | 4.3 / 5.0 |
| Total Reviews | 338 |
(As of March 15, 2026)
Positive Review Trends
- It receives enthusiastic support from those who want a break from tonkotsu, praised as one of the best places in Kumamoto to get authentic miso and shoyu ramen.
- The medium-thick, slightly wavy egg noodles pair perfectly with the soup, and the melt-in-your-mouth chashu (braised pork) is highly rated.
- The owner’s gentle personality and the nostalgic, cozy atmosphere of the tiny shop make customers want to linger and become regulars.
Areas for Improvement / Negative Trends
- Because it is a very small shop with only a few counter seats, it fills up instantly during the lunch rush, and lines are common.
- Parking is limited to just two spaces, so drivers should be prepared to look for nearby coin parking.

Tips for Your Visit
- A popular strategy among regulars is to order some of the owner’s special daily side dishes with a drink, and then order a “Half Ramen” to finish off the meal perfectly.
- To avoid long waits, try visiting right at opening time or slightly past the peak lunch hour.
